I found Kingston to be very pedestrian friendly.

I found Kingston to be very pedestrian friendly. There are many restaurants, cafes and bars that cater to all palates. The walk along the waterfront is very scenic. Springer Market Square is a very dynamic area and accommodates activities which can include outdoor ice skating, outdoor movies, dancing and actual stalls vending commodities from food to artisanal goods. The transportation system was safe and punctual and there are several taxi companies too. Lake Ontario Park, across from the St. Lawrence Residence, has beautiful paths through wooded and lakeshore ares.

I think that the two most beautiful cities in Canada are...

I think that the two most beautiful cities in Canada are Kingston, Ontario and Victoria, BC. Both are smaller cities without the congestion, crime, or architectural monotony of many larger metropolitan centers. It is true that they are lacking some amenities but they "hit way above their weight class" (with world class hospitals, a long and interesting history, unique shops, high quality restaurants, a vibrant retail sector, a large arena, and a beautiful waterfront that envelops a large part of the city) due to the high inflowing revenues (in Kingston's case this is due to the huge number of students attending Queen's St Lawrence, and RMC, the large number of institutions nearby from hospitals to prisons)
